    Heiland bodies are extremely common (for now). They were mass produced and many companies completely unrelated to Heiland use them (such as MPP, which was the real brand used for the Vader ANH and ESB). There are generic bodies that you can get at lots of places on the internet in the event you mess one up. It's the accessories that are more important. Keep them safe in a box, and you can do your conversion on the main body.
